The Evolution of Medical Credentialing
For years, medical licensing was a localized, manual endeavor. Each state or local board operated separately, typically with unique requirements and manual verification processes. This fragmentation often led to delays in staffing, especially throughout public health crises when the rapid mobilization of health care workers was vital.

The combination of online platforms has bridged these gaps. By centralizing data and automating confirmation, these platforms have transitioned the industry from a "siloed" method to a more interconnected community. This evolution has actually been further accelerated by initiatives like the Interstate Medical Licensure Compact (IMLC), which uses digital interfaces to permit doctors to practice across numerous state lines more effectively.

Challenges and Security Considerations
Despite the clear benefits, the implementation of medical license online platforms is not without difficulties. Since these systems home highly delicate individual and expert information-- including Social Security numbers, home addresses, and academic records-- they are prime targets for cyberattacks.

As innovation continues to advance, the next generation of medical license platforms will likely incorporate much more advanced tools. Blockchain innovation is currently being explored as a method for producing immutable "digital badges" for credentials. This would permit a physician to carry a confirmed "digital wallet" of their accomplishments that could be quickly accepted by any medical facility or state board without the need for repetitive primary source verification.

In addition, Artificial Intelligence (AI) is starting to play a role in determining discrepancies in applications. AI algorithms can flag irregular dates or suspicious gaps in employment history far quicker than a human auditor, further increasing the security and dependability of the licensing procedure.

2. Can I use one platform to get licenses in numerous states?
It depends upon the platform. The Federation of State Medical Boards (FSMB) provides the Uniform Application (UA), which enables specialists to utilize a single set of core data to use to numerous getting involved state boards.
